EIGRP的配置

在这里插入图片描述

  1. EIGRP的基本配置
    只需要两步就可以启动一个EIGRP进程

    R1(config)#router eigrp 90   
    R1(config-router)#network 172.20.0.0 0.0.255.255
    

EIGRP进程ID可以是1~65535(0不允许使用)之间的任何一个数字,只要对必须共享路由信息的所有路由器的EIGRP进程ID配置相同就可以。另外,这个进程ID也可是公共分配的自主系统号。
EIGRP默认的管理距离:内部路由为90,外部路由为170,汇总路由为5.
在这里插入图片描述
计算192.168.16.0/24的度量,从R1到达网络192.168.16.0/24穿过了一个串行接口和一个环回接口(只考虑路由器的出端接口的参数):
串口S1/1
在这里插入图片描述
环回接口0
在这里插入图片描述
根据EIGRP度量的计算公式:
在这里插入图片描述

  1. 非等价负载均衡
    在和RIP协议相同的CEF/快速转发/进程转发(CEF/fast/process switching )三种转发机制的限制下,EIGRP最多可以在16条等价的路由路径上实现等价负载均衡。但与RIP协议不同的是EIGRP协议也可以实现非等价负载均衡,即将流量按照各条链路度量比例分布到各条链路上同时传输,度量越小分布流量越多。
    在这里插入图片描述
    从R1到达192.168.17.0/24网络有两个可行后继路由器,即有两条路径。路由表优选度量小的加表。现在我们让两条都加表实现非等价的负载均衡。

    R1(config)#router ei 90
    R1(config-router)#variance ?
      <1-128>  Metric variance multiplier
    R1(config-router)#variance 2 %因为2297856/1639936=1.4
    

    在这里插入图片描述
    可以看到虽然两个路径的度量不同但是都加表了。
    差异变量(variance)命令用来确定哪些路由在非等价负载均衡中是可以使用的。Variance定义了一个倍数因子,用来表示一条路由的度量值和最小代价路由的差异程度。任何路由的度量值如果超过了最小路由度量值乘以variance的值,那么这条路由将不被使用。
    Variance的缺省值为1,即路由器默认等价负载均衡。且variance的值必须为整数。
    在配置非等价负载均衡需要注意以下情况:

  • 增加到负载共享“组”中的路由条目不能超过最大路径数的限制。
  • 邻居通告距离必须满足FC。
  • 最小路由代价的度量值乘以variance后,必须要大于要增加的路由度量值。
    如果数据转发是快速转发或是缺省的CEF,就是按照每目的的负载均衡。如果数据转发是进程转发或修改的CEF转发,就是每数据包转发。
  1. 末梢路由选择
    当一台路由器的拓扑结构表变坏的时候(可能是度量值变大了,可能是后继路由器不再可达了),如果没有可行后继路由器可以到达该地址。那么这个路由条目将进入active 状态,同时这台路由器将会向它的所有邻居路由器发送查询数据包。
    为了减少网络不稳定的风险,不需要向网络末端的路由器发送查询报文。我们可以将这些末端的路由器保护起来。

     R2(config)#router ei 90
     R2(config-router)#eigrp stub 
    

一台具有eigrp末梢邻居的路由器将不会再向它的末梢发送查询,因此这就排除了末梢的远端站点引起“卡”在活动状态的情形发生。也降低了网络中其余部分的路由选择的不稳定。
命令eigrp stub 默认情况下会使路由器仅仅发送包含与它直连的路由和汇总路由的更新消息。
但我们也可以灵活的修改:

	R2(config-router)#eigrp stub ?
	  connected      Do advertise connected routes
	  leak-map       Allow dynamic prefixes based on the leak-map
	  receive-only   Set IP-EIGRP as receive only neighbor
	  redistributed  Do advertise redistributed routes
	  static         Do advertise static routes
	  summary        Do advertise summary routes
	  <cr>

其中 receive-only选项配置为在更新消息中不发送任何路由信息。
配置EIGRP的末梢路由选择可以最大限度的减少查询的数量。

  1. 地址汇总
    地址汇总可以减少路由数量,加快路由匹配速度。也可以用于隐藏网络的细节部分。

     R2(config)#interface s1/0
     R2(config-if)#ip summary-address eigrp 90 IP address  IP network mask
    
  2. 认证
    EIGRP仅支持MD5加密认证
    EIGRP的认证步骤:
    1)定义一个有名字的钥匙链
    2)在钥匙链上定义一个或一组钥匙
    3)在接口上启用认证并指定使用的钥匙链
    4)可选的配置钥匙管理

     R2(config)#key chain EIGRP 
     R2(config-keychain)#key 1
     R2(config-keychain-key)#key-string cisco123
     R2(config-keychain-key)#send-lifetime 22:10:05 July 3 2019 infinite  
     R2(config-keychain-key)#accept-lifetime 22:10:05 July 3 2019 infinite 
    
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值